atividade 8 - construção de algoritimos
0,2 em 0,2 pontos Correta
Dado um vetor (vet) de 10 elementos inteiros, complete as lacunas do trecho de algoritmo a seguir para imprimir a metade de cada elemento do vetor.
int i, metade; int vet[] = {10, 20, 30, 40, 50, 60, 70, 80, 90, 100}; for( i = 0; _________; i++){ ____________________________ ; System.out.println( metade );
}
Assinalar a alternativa correta:
Resposta
Resposta Selecionada: b. i < 10, metade = vet[i] / 2;
Resposta Correta: b. i < 10, metade = vet[i] / 2;
Feedback da resposta:
Correto.
Pergunta 2
0,2 em 0,2 pontos Correta
Analise a instrução a seguir: int v[] = new int[5]; Essa instrução corresponde a:
Resposta
Resposta Selecionada: e.
Declaração de um vetor chamado “v”, do tipo inteiro, com capacidade para armazenar 5 elementos.
Resposta Correta: e.
Declaração de um vetor chamado “v”, do tipo inteiro, com capacidade para armazenar 5 elementos.
Feedback da resposta:
Correto.
Pergunta 3
0,2 em 0,2 pontos Correta
Dado o vetor V abaixo: vetor Qual será seu conteúdo do vetor V depois de executado o algoritmo a seguir?
int i, aux; for(i = 7; i >= 4; i--){ aux = v[ i ]; v[ i ] = v[ 7 - i ]; v[ 7 - i ] = aux;
}
Resposta
Resposta Selecionada: e.
6, 3, 8, 7, 2, 4, 1, 5
Resposta Correta: e.
6, 3, 8, 7, 2, 4, 1, 5
Feedback da resposta:
Correto.
Pergunta 4
0,2 em 0,2 pontos Correta
Assinale a alternativa que corresponde à saída vista pelo usuário ao executar o programa abaixo. public static void main(String[] args) { int vA[] = new int[5]; int vB[] = new int[5]; int i;
for (i = 0; i < vA.length; i++) { vA[i] = i; } for (i = 0; i < vA.length; i++) { if (vA[i] % 2 == 0) { vB[i] = 0; } else { vB[i] = 1; }